WebSep 21, 2024 · To be able to use the microwave to peel peppers, you will first need to cut open the peppers, remove the seeds and cut into strips. Second, place the peppers in a microwave container and heat for 3-4 minutes. Next, place the peppers in a paper bag that is tightly sealed for 10 minutes. Finally, remove the cooled peppers from the bag and …

WebThe key is to use a sawing motion with the peeler. Top and tail the pepper, cut it in half or quarters, remove the seeds and pith, then take a peeler (one like this): and start peeling, wiggling the peeler side to side, 'sawing' the skin off the flesh. WebFeb 15, 2024 · To peel peppers with boiling water, first cut the peppers in half and remove the seeds. Next, bring a pot of water to a boil and add the peppers. Join me in the kitchen on my Roasted Poblano Chiles TheSeasonedCook 77K... god bless you psdWebApr 13, 2024 · Roasting whole bell peppers in the oven.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F. Place on a baking sheet and roast for 20-30 minutes or until the skin is blistered and charred to your liking. Turn each one occasionally to ensure even cooking and browning. Remove and let them cool for a few minutes before peeling off the skin. god bless you photos
